Christmas Can't Be Far Away lyrics

A neighbor tipped his hat to me this mornin'
The landlord even smiled and said good day
And I want you to know that a stranger said hello
Christmas can't be far away

Old tight wad down the street is a buying candy
To pass out to the neighbor kids at play
The town is on the go and the weather man says snow
Christmas can't be far away

The small fry on our block have all been saving
And now their hiding things and looking sly
Mum will get that doodad she's been craving
And dad will get his usual Christmas tie

Both young and old are planning sweet surprises
They'll soon be tied with ribbons bright and gay
Good will is in the air and you feel it everywhere
Christmas can't be far away

Good will is in the air and you feel it everywhere
Christmas can't be far away
